How to uninstall Microsoft Security Essentials Prerelease from your PC

Microsoft Security Essentials Prerelease is a Windows application. Read more about how to uninstall it from your PC. The Windows version was created by Microsoft Corporation. More information on Microsoft Corporation can be seen here. Further information about Microsoft Security Essentials Prerelease can be seen at . Microsoft Security Essentials Prerelease is typically set up in the C:\Program Files\Microsoft Security Client directory, regulated by the user's decision. C:\Program Files\Microsoft Security Client\Setup.exe /x is the full command line if you want to uninstall Microsoft Security Essentials Prerelease. setup.exe is the Microsoft Security Essentials Prerelease's main executable file and it occupies around 1.05 MB (1104832 bytes) on disk.

The executables below are part of Microsoft Security Essentials Prerelease. They take about 4.72 MB (4944320 bytes) on disk.

  • MpCmdRun.exe (378.24 KB)
  • MsMpEng.exe (23.26 KB)
  • msseces.exe (1.28 MB)
  • msseoobe.exe (605.45 KB)
  • NisSrv.exe (357.95 KB)
  • setup.exe (1.05 MB)

Some files and registry entries are usually left behind when you uninstall Microsoft Security Essentials Prerelease.

Directories left on disk:
  • C:\Program Files\Microsoft Security Client

The files below remain on your disk when you remove Microsoft Security Essentials Prerelease:
  • C:\Program Files\Microsoft Security Client\Backup\amd64\dw20shared.msi
  • C:\Program Files\Microsoft Security Client\Backup\amd64\epp.msi
  • C:\Program Files\Microsoft Security Client\Backup\amd64\setup.exe
  • C:\Program Files\Microsoft Security Client\Backup\amd64\sqmapi.dll

Registry keys:
  • HKEY_CLASSES_ROOT\TypeLib\{84DCD935-B80A-4DBA-8530-F151736F7F8C}
  • HKEY_CLASSES_ROOT\TypeLib\{8C389764-F036-48F2-9AE2-88C260DCF400}
  • H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E\Software\Microsoft\Windows\CurrentVersion\Uninstall\Microsoft Security Client
